魔域數(shù)據(jù)庫修改方案_第1頁
魔域數(shù)據(jù)庫修改方案_第2頁
魔域數(shù)據(jù)庫修改方案_第3頁
魔域數(shù)據(jù)庫修改方案_第4頁
魔域數(shù)據(jù)庫修改方案_第5頁
已閱讀5頁,還剩2頁未讀 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

?魔域數(shù)據(jù)庫修改方案一、背景分析咱們得了解一下魔域數(shù)據(jù)庫的現(xiàn)狀。經(jīng)過長時(shí)間的使用,數(shù)據(jù)庫出現(xiàn)了一些性能瓶頸,數(shù)據(jù)結(jié)構(gòu)不合理,查詢效率低下,這直接影響了用戶體驗(yàn)和系統(tǒng)運(yùn)行效率。所以,修改數(shù)據(jù)庫成了當(dāng)務(wù)之急。二、目標(biāo)定位我們得明確這次數(shù)據(jù)庫修改的目標(biāo)。要提高數(shù)據(jù)庫的查詢效率,優(yōu)化數(shù)據(jù)結(jié)構(gòu);確保數(shù)據(jù)安全,防止數(shù)據(jù)泄露;提高系統(tǒng)的穩(wěn)定性,降低故障率。三、具體方案1.數(shù)據(jù)表結(jié)構(gòu)優(yōu)化(1)合并冗余字段,減少數(shù)據(jù)表寬度,提高查詢速度。(2)調(diào)整數(shù)據(jù)表索引,提高查詢效率。(3)對于經(jīng)常一起查詢的字段,可以考慮建立關(guān)聯(lián)表,減少JOIN操作,提高查詢速度。2.數(shù)據(jù)庫分區(qū)為了提高數(shù)據(jù)庫的查詢效率,我們可以對數(shù)據(jù)庫進(jìn)行分區(qū)。具體操作如下:(1)根據(jù)業(yè)務(wù)需求,將數(shù)據(jù)表分為若干個(gè)分區(qū)。(2)設(shè)置分區(qū)策略,如范圍分區(qū)、列表分區(qū)等。(3)定期進(jìn)行分區(qū)維護(hù),如合并分區(qū)、刪除過期數(shù)據(jù)等。3.緩存機(jī)制引入緩存機(jī)制,減輕數(shù)據(jù)庫壓力,提高查詢速度。具體操作如下:(1)選擇合適的緩存技術(shù),如Redis、Memcached等。(2)設(shè)置緩存策略,如LRU(最近最少使用)算法、TTL(生存時(shí)間)等。(3)緩存數(shù)據(jù)同步更新,確保數(shù)據(jù)一致性。4.數(shù)據(jù)安全(1)加強(qiáng)數(shù)據(jù)加密,防止數(shù)據(jù)泄露。(2)設(shè)置權(quán)限控制,限制用戶對數(shù)據(jù)庫的操作。(3)定期進(jìn)行數(shù)據(jù)備份,確保數(shù)據(jù)不丟失。5.系統(tǒng)穩(wěn)定性(1)對數(shù)據(jù)庫進(jìn)行定期維護(hù),如檢查碎片、優(yōu)化索引等。(2)設(shè)置數(shù)據(jù)庫監(jiān)控,及時(shí)發(fā)現(xiàn)并解決故障。(3)采用高可用數(shù)據(jù)庫架構(gòu),如主從復(fù)制、讀寫分離等。四、實(shí)施步驟1.分析現(xiàn)有數(shù)據(jù)庫結(jié)構(gòu),找出問題所在。2.設(shè)計(jì)優(yōu)化方案,包括數(shù)據(jù)表結(jié)構(gòu)優(yōu)化、數(shù)據(jù)庫分區(qū)、緩存機(jī)制等。3.進(jìn)行方案評估,確保方案可行。4.編寫實(shí)施計(jì)劃,明確實(shí)施步驟、時(shí)間表等。5.逐步實(shí)施優(yōu)化方案,確保系統(tǒng)穩(wěn)定運(yùn)行。6.對優(yōu)化后的數(shù)據(jù)庫進(jìn)行測試,驗(yàn)證優(yōu)化效果。五、預(yù)期效果1.數(shù)據(jù)庫查詢效率提高,用戶體驗(yàn)得到提升。2.數(shù)據(jù)安全得到保障,降低數(shù)據(jù)泄露風(fēng)險(xiǎn)。3.系統(tǒng)穩(wěn)定性提高,故障率降低。4.業(yè)務(wù)發(fā)展得到支持,為后續(xù)擴(kuò)展奠定基礎(chǔ)。注意事項(xiàng):1.數(shù)據(jù)遷移風(fēng)險(xiǎn)注意事項(xiàng):遷移數(shù)據(jù)時(shí)可能會出現(xiàn)數(shù)據(jù)丟失或損壞的風(fēng)險(xiǎn)。解決辦法:在遷移前做好詳細(xì)的數(shù)據(jù)備份,確保每一條數(shù)據(jù)都有備份記錄。同時(shí),進(jìn)行小規(guī)模的數(shù)據(jù)遷移測試,驗(yàn)證遷移過程是否穩(wěn)定可靠。2.系統(tǒng)兼容性問題注意事項(xiàng):修改數(shù)據(jù)庫后,可能會與現(xiàn)有系統(tǒng)產(chǎn)生兼容性問題。解決辦法:在修改前,對現(xiàn)有系統(tǒng)進(jìn)行全面的兼容性測試,確保修改后的數(shù)據(jù)庫能夠與現(xiàn)有系統(tǒng)無縫對接。及時(shí)更新相關(guān)依賴庫和組件。3.用戶權(quán)限管理注意事項(xiàng):修改數(shù)據(jù)庫結(jié)構(gòu)后,用戶權(quán)限管理可能會受到影響。解決辦法:在修改過程中,詳細(xì)記錄用戶權(quán)限設(shè)置,并在修改后重新分配權(quán)限,確保每個(gè)用戶都能正常訪問所需數(shù)據(jù)。4.緩存數(shù)據(jù)同步注意事項(xiàng):引入緩存機(jī)制后,數(shù)據(jù)同步更新可能成為問題。解決辦法:設(shè)計(jì)一套緩存數(shù)據(jù)同步策略,確保緩存中的數(shù)據(jù)與數(shù)據(jù)庫中的數(shù)據(jù)保持一致。定期檢查和刷新緩存數(shù)據(jù)。5.數(shù)據(jù)安全措施注意事項(xiàng):加強(qiáng)數(shù)據(jù)安全措施時(shí),可能會影響系統(tǒng)性能。解決辦法:選擇高效的數(shù)據(jù)加密算法,避免對系統(tǒng)性能產(chǎn)生太大影響。同時(shí),合理設(shè)置權(quán)限,只允許授權(quán)用戶訪問敏感數(shù)據(jù)。6.維護(hù)成本上升注意事項(xiàng):數(shù)據(jù)庫修改后,維護(hù)成本可能會增加。解決辦法:通過自動(dòng)化工具和腳本,減少人工維護(hù)成本。定期培訓(xùn)維護(hù)人員,提高維護(hù)效率。7.用戶培訓(xùn)注意事項(xiàng):修改后的數(shù)據(jù)庫操作方式可能發(fā)生變化,用戶需要重新學(xué)習(xí)。解決辦法:在修改前,制定詳細(xì)的用戶培訓(xùn)計(jì)劃,通過線上或線下培訓(xùn),幫助用戶快速掌握新的操作方式。8.長期規(guī)劃注意事項(xiàng):修改數(shù)據(jù)庫時(shí),需要考慮長期規(guī)劃和未來發(fā)展。解決辦法:與業(yè)務(wù)團(tuán)隊(duì)緊密合作,了解未來業(yè)務(wù)發(fā)展需求,確保數(shù)據(jù)庫修改方案能夠滿足長期發(fā)展的需要。避免頻繁修改,造成資源浪費(fèi)。1.數(shù)據(jù)庫性能監(jiān)控要點(diǎn):實(shí)時(shí)監(jiān)控?cái)?shù)據(jù)庫性能,確保優(yōu)化效果。解決辦法:部署專業(yè)的數(shù)據(jù)庫監(jiān)控工具,實(shí)時(shí)跟蹤數(shù)據(jù)庫的運(yùn)行狀態(tài),包括響應(yīng)時(shí)間、負(fù)載情況、查詢效率等。一旦發(fā)現(xiàn)異常,立即進(jìn)行排查和調(diào)整。2.跨部門溝通協(xié)作要點(diǎn):確保修改過程中跨部門之間的溝通順暢。解決辦法:建立跨部門溝通機(jī)制,定期召開協(xié)調(diào)會議,讓開發(fā)、運(yùn)維、測試等部門共同參與,確保信息傳遞及時(shí)準(zhǔn)確,避免信息孤島。3.修改前的風(fēng)險(xiǎn)評估要點(diǎn):對修改可能帶來的風(fēng)險(xiǎn)進(jìn)行預(yù)評估。解決辦法:組織專家團(tuán)隊(duì),對修改方案進(jìn)行風(fēng)險(xiǎn)評估,列出所有可能的風(fēng)險(xiǎn)點(diǎn),并制定相應(yīng)的應(yīng)對措施。這樣可以提前預(yù)防,減少實(shí)施過程中的意外。4.用戶反饋收集要點(diǎn):積極收集用戶對修改后的數(shù)據(jù)庫反饋。解決辦法:設(shè)置用戶反饋渠道,如在線問卷調(diào)查、用戶論壇等,鼓勵(lì)用戶提出意見和建議。根據(jù)用戶反饋,及時(shí)調(diào)整優(yōu)化方案,確保更貼近用戶需求。5.系統(tǒng)回滾方案要點(diǎn):準(zhǔn)備一套系統(tǒng)回滾方案,以應(yīng)對修改失敗的情況。解決辦法:在修改前,制定詳細(xì)的回滾計(jì)劃,包括回滾步驟、所需資源和人員安排。確保在修改失敗時(shí),能夠迅速恢復(fù)到原始狀態(tài),減少對業(yè)務(wù)的影響。6.文檔和知識共享要點(diǎn):記錄修改過程,形成文檔,便于知識共享。解決辦法:在修改過程中,詳細(xì)記錄每一步的操作和調(diào)整,形成操作手冊和知識庫。這不僅有助于內(nèi)部人員學(xué)習(xí)和傳承,也能為后續(xù)的維護(hù)工作提供參考。7.測試用例準(zhǔn)備要點(diǎn):準(zhǔn)備充分的測試用例,確保修改后的數(shù)據(jù)庫穩(wěn)定可靠。解決辦法:根據(jù)業(yè)務(wù)場景,設(shè)計(jì)覆蓋全面的測試用例,包括功能測試、性能測試、安全測試等。通過測試,

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論